What does a lead generation strategist do?

A Lead Generation Strategist is responsible for creating and implementing strategies to attract and capture potential customers (leads) for a business. They analyze target audiences, select the best channels (like email, social media, or paid advertising), and design campaigns to generate qualified leads for sales teams. Their role often involves tracking results, optimizing campaigns, and working closely with marketing and sales departments to ensure a steady flow of high-quality leads.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a lead generation strategist?

To thrive as a Lead Generation Strategist, you need strong analytical abilities, marketing knowledge, and experience with customer acquisition strategies, often supported by a degree in marketing or business. Familiarity with CRM platforms (like Salesforce or HubSpot), marketing automation tools, and data analytics software is typically required. Outstanding communication, creativity, and adaptability help you craft compelling campaigns and collaborate across teams. These skills are crucial for efficiently identifying and nurturing high-quality leads, driving business growth, and optimizing marketing ROI.

How does a lead generation strategist typically collaborate with sales and marketing teams?

A Lead Generation Strategist works closely with both sales and marketing teams to design and implement campaigns that attract high-quality prospects. They regularly meet with marketers to align on messaging, content, and target audiences, while also coordinating with sales to ensure leads meet qualification criteria and are handed off efficiently. This role often involves analyzing campaign performance and adjusting strategies based on feedback from both teams, fostering a collaborative environment focused on continuous improvement and shared goals.

What is the difference between Lead Generation Strategist vs Digital Marketing Specialist?

AspectLead Generation StrategistDigital Marketing Specialist
Primary FocusGenerating and qualifying leads to support salesCreating and executing marketing campaigns across digital channels
Skills & CertificationsCRM tools, data analysis, marketing automationSEO, SEM, content marketing, analytics
Work EnvironmentSales teams, marketing departments, B2B/B2C companiesMarketing agencies, in-house marketing teams, digital platforms

While both roles involve digital marketing skills, a Lead Generation Strategist primarily focuses on developing strategies to attract and qualify leads for sales teams, whereas a Digital Marketing Specialist manages broader online marketing campaigns. The roles often overlap but differ in their core objectives and daily tasks.

About the Role

The Lead Generation Specialist reports to the Sales Director and is responsible for researching, identifying, prospecting, and qualifying new sales leads to support the sales team. This individual is a highly motivated, creative self-starter able to identify and develop new business prospects from multiple sources including independent industry research, prospect lists, and inbound marketing leads. A resilient, dynamic personality with a drive and the personal skills needed to reach decision makers is essential.

Responsibilities

Market Research

  • Identify prospective clients through resources provided and independent research
  • Categorize prospective clients based on business needs
  • Develop strategic approaches to engage with new prospects, current and past clients, using LinkedIn, Sales Navigator, ZoomInfo, Zoho CRM and other available sources of information to identify new business opportunities and develop prospect- and client-specific profile information
  • Assist in monitoring market trends and analyzing competition 
  • Prepare and manage all prospecting lists


Lead Generation

  • Build and cultivate prospect relationships by initiating communications and conducting follow-up communications to move opportunities through the sales funnel
  • Utilize individual and mass email and phone calls for prospecting. Daily cold calling is required.
  • Understand and communicate common business problems and relevant B3 solutions to influence prospects to attend product demonstrations
  • Set up and execute qualification calls with prospects, ensuring mutual understanding of each prospect's situation, problems, and needs
  • Set up demonstration meetings for qualified prospects
  • Coordinate all leads obtained through marketing activities, including immediate direct follow up with qualified leads to determine opportunity status
  • Assist prospects in thinking through issues and problems and facilitating their involvement in arriving at solutions or improvement strategies

 Sales Administration

  • Work with sales team on all aspects of the sales process to ensure the business is efficiently and effectively executed
  • Manage and coordinate prospect- and client-specific information within Zoho CRM to ensure opportunities are added to the system and data is accurate and up-to-date
  • Manage data in Zoho CRM ensuring all communications are tracked, information in database is clean and accurate and documents are attached
  • Ensure the integrity of the data in Zoho CRM by reviewing it frequently and helping Sales and Marketing team members correct inaccuracies
  • Track demos/meetings for sales team
  • Track and monitor customer renewals for sales team
  • Taking detailed notes and follow ups for the sales team in demonstrations and presentations
  • Ability and willingness to travel on occasion


Marketing Support

  • Assist in Marketing/Sales-sponsored events, including event attendee analysis and logistics preparation, as well as follow-up with attendees
  • Define, gather, and report on metrics that demonstrate the efficacy of marketing efforts
  • Be an ongoing contributor to the development and execution of marketing initiatives to drive traffic, increase sales and brand awareness
  • Assist with various email marketing campaigns, social media platforms, website and content initiatives
  • Monitor customer access and notify Marketing/Sales of heavily and underutilized accounts
